From 7a7dc732599b358b25b770cfc27036f4b403d1b4 Mon Sep 17 00:00:00 2001
From: Benjamin Auder <benjamin.auder@somewhere>
Date: Tue, 13 Feb 2018 14:29:48 +0100
Subject: [PATCH] remove extra step in end assessment process

---
 models/assessment.js  | 8 --------
 routes/assessments.js | 2 +-
 stt.csv               | 4 ++++
 3 files changed, 5 insertions(+), 9 deletions(-)
 create mode 100644 stt.csv

diff --git a/models/assessment.js b/models/assessment.js
index 8bc08d5..d0e0d0b 100644
--- a/models/assessment.js
+++ b/models/assessment.js
@@ -126,14 +126,6 @@ const AssessmentModel =
 				AssessmentEntity.addDisco(aid, number, Date.now() - discoTime);
 		});
 	},
-
-	endSession: function(aid, number, password, cb)
-	{
-		AssessmentEntity.endAssessment(aid, number, password, (err,ret) => {
-			if (!!err || !ret)
-				return cb(err,ret);
-		});
-	},
 };
 
 module.exports = AssessmentModel;
diff --git a/routes/assessments.js b/routes/assessments.js
index c1a99cf..3a91b5a 100644
--- a/routes/assessments.js
+++ b/routes/assessments.js
@@ -119,7 +119,7 @@ router.get("/end/assessment", access.ajax, (req,res) => {
 	if (error.length > 0)
 		return res.json({errmsg:error});
 	// Destroy pwd, set endTime
-	AssessmentModel.endSession(ObjectId(aid), number, password, (err,ret) => {
+	AssessmentEntity.endAssessment(ObjectId(aid), number, password, (err,ret) => {
 		access.checkRequest(res,err,ret,"Cannot end assessment", () => {
 			res.clearCookie('password');
 			res.json({});
diff --git a/stt.csv b/stt.csv
new file mode 100644
index 0000000..5bd2d4a
--- /dev/null
+++ b/stt.csv
@@ -0,0 +1,4 @@
+name
+PLAISANCE William
+DUPUY Rosamonde
+AUBIN Fabienne
-- 
2.44.0